
PHP and MySQL functions
- or -
Post a project like this4093
£100(approx. $136)
- Posted:
- Proposals: 1
- Remote
- #452045
- Awarded
Description
Experience Level: Intermediate
Estimated project duration: 1 - 2 weeks
General information for the website: Database that records software installation requests at a location and what has already been installed.
Kind of development: Customization of existing website
Num. of web pages/modules: 6
Description of requirements/features: 1: Log which users made the software installation request and show their username in the details section of a request.
2: Search - Searches 'software' database table for existing database entries (by software name only) and returns results. Ideally shows 'similar' results and realtime results for existing entries.
3: Export to Excel - Page already has a table of installed software from a MySQL table, button should export all entries to a csv/xls file so it can be opened in Microsoft Excel.
4: Stop duplicate database entries - A request for already installed software shouldn't be possible with a message saying it is already in the table. Site also currently allows multiple entries of same data, it should not allow entry into the database as well as output error messages saying it couldn't be done.
5: Tooltip - 3 pages currently contain text input fields. When input box is selected, a tooltip box to appear with text to let the user know what sort of input is acceptable.
6: Prevent SQL injection and security - Make input into the boxes secure
Extra services needed: Security
Extra notes: Don't have a domain or hosting as it is being hosted locally until it is completed.
Kind of development: Customization of existing website
Num. of web pages/modules: 6
Description of requirements/features: 1: Log which users made the software installation request and show their username in the details section of a request.
2: Search - Searches 'software' database table for existing database entries (by software name only) and returns results. Ideally shows 'similar' results and realtime results for existing entries.
3: Export to Excel - Page already has a table of installed software from a MySQL table, button should export all entries to a csv/xls file so it can be opened in Microsoft Excel.
4: Stop duplicate database entries - A request for already installed software shouldn't be possible with a message saying it is already in the table. Site also currently allows multiple entries of same data, it should not allow entry into the database as well as output error messages saying it couldn't be done.
5: Tooltip - 3 pages currently contain text input fields. When input box is selected, a tooltip box to appear with text to let the user know what sort of input is acceptable.
6: Prevent SQL injection and security - Make input into the boxes secure
Extra services needed: Security
Extra notes: Don't have a domain or hosting as it is being hosted locally until it is completed.

Ahmed A.
100% (1)Projects Completed
1
Freelancers worked with
1
Projects awarded
100%
Last project
2 Apr 2014
United Kingdom
New Proposal
Login to your account and send a proposal now to get this project.
Log inClarification Board Ask a Question
-
There are no clarification messages.
We collect cookies to enable the proper functioning and security of our website, and to enhance your experience. By clicking on 'Accept All Cookies', you consent to the use of these cookies. You can change your 'Cookies Settings' at any time. For more information, please read ourCookie Policy
Cookie Settings
Accept All Cookies